Capaldi Roasts Proposal Mid-Concert!

Lewis Capaldi recently halted his Sydney concert to playfully address a couple's mid-performance engagement. He lightheartedly informed them, 'How dare you come here and propose! This is my show.' This playful interaction comes after a trend of marriage proposals during his shows, including a recent instance in Brisbane where a fan proposed while Capaldi was singing. Capaldi's own history with these events includes inviting a couple on stage for a proposal during a UK concert in 2023.

Capaldi, who has been touring Australia after a break and a notable Glastonbury set, is currently on his highly anticipated Australian tour. He last visited the country for the Falls Festival in 2019. His current tour includes stops in Melbourne and Adelaide before concluding in Perth.

The singer-songwriter, known for hits like 'Someone You Loved,' has been enjoying a strong reception during his return to the stage. His Australian tour dates extend into December 2025, marking a significant comeback for the artist.
